VENEZUELA: A New Life for At-Risk Kids, and Music Too!

by Humberto Márquez , IPS Inter Press Service - Culture, Religion, Sport on Aug 24, 2007

CARACAS, Aug 24 (IPS) - On tour in Germany after performing to rave reviews
at the BBC Promenade Concerts in London, the members of
Venezuela’s Simón Bolívar Youth Symphony Orchestra and its
wild-haired conductor, Gustavo Dudamel, have made a remarkable
journey from their less than promising social origins.
